What does population distribution describe?
People across a given area
What are typical characteristics of densely populated areas?
Urban centers, fertile plains
What is an example of a physical factor influencing population distribution?
Climate
What are common characteristics of densely populated areas?
High population density
What is an example of a densely populated region in East Asia?
Tokyo
Which river valley supports a high population density in India and Bangladesh?
Ganges River Valley
